免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
123下一页
最近访问板块 发新帖
查看: 36069 | 回复: 25

linux上ifconfig -a显示RX Packets的errors不为0表示什么意思 [复制链接]

论坛徽章:
0
发表于 2009-07-20 15:09 |显示全部楼层
30可用积分
我这里有一台机器,装的debian 4.0的操作系统。
ping它,发现丢包率有40%
ifconfig -a显示
bond0     Link encap:Ethernet  HWaddr 00:10:18:31:6C:63  
          inet addr:192.168.1.61  Bcast:192.168.1.255  Mask:255.255.255.0
          inet6 addr: fe80::210:18ff:fe31:6c63/64 Scope:Link
          UP BROADCAST RUNNING MASTER MULTICAST  MTU:1500  Metric:1
          RX packets:228939416 errors:216633 dropped:60 overruns:0 frame:6
          TX packets:9457743 errors:0 dropped:0 overruns:0 carrier:0
          collisions:238335 txqueuelen:0
          RX bytes:800666214 (763.5 MiB)  TX bytes:1980557081 (1.8 GiB)

eth0      Link encap:UNSPEC  HWaddr 80-4F-1E-00-3D-0F-AA-00-00-00-00-00-00-00-00-00  
          BROADCAST MULTICAST  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)

eth1      Link encap:Ethernet  HWaddr 00:10:18:31:6C:63  
          UP BROADCAST SLAVE MULTICAST  MTU:1500  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)
          Interrupt:169

eth2      Link encap:Ethernet  HWaddr 00:10:18:31:6C:63  
          inet addr:169.254.30.78  Bcast:169.254.255.255  Mask:255.255.0.0
          inet6 addr: fe80::210:18ff:fe31:6c63/64 Scope:Link
          UP BROADCAST RUNNING SLAVE MULTICAST  MTU:1500  Metric:1
          RX packets:228939416 errors:216633 dropped:60 overruns:0 frame:6
          TX packets:9457743 errors:0 dropped:0 overruns:0 carrier:0
          collisions:238335 txqueuelen:1000
          RX bytes:800666214 (763.5 MiB)  TX bytes:1980557081 (1.8 GiB)
          Interrupt:169

lo        Link encap:Local Loopback  
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:757994464 errors:0 dropped:0 overruns:0 frame:0
          TX packets:757994464 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:3071203309 (2.8 GiB)  TX bytes:3071203309 (2.8 GiB)

sit0      Link encap:IPv6-in-IPv4  
          NOARP  MTU:1480  Metric:1
          RX packets:0 errors:0 dropped:0 overruns:0 frame:0
          T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:0 (0.0 b)  TX bytes:0 (0.0 b)

上google找了很多一般说可能是配置的问题,
但是用户说把程序重启了一下,就不丢包了
我想问一下,errors表示啥意思,
硬件什么情况下会导致这个问题?
软件什么情况下会导致这个问题?
--------------------------------------------------------------------------------------------------------
以前的帖子
http://bbs2.chinaunix.net/thread-1372876-1-1.html
我这里有2台DS20E的机器,上面跑了生产系统
现在有这样的一个问题,就是机器运行个1个月的样子,网卡的网速会由100M变成10-100k的样子
重启网络服务网速会恢复,还有可以把现在运行的网卡切换到备用网卡上,网速也会恢复
说明一下,机器是装Tru64 5.1b操作系统
网卡用了tru64上面的工具,做了网卡冗余,就是2个网卡绑定一个ip
交换机用的cisco 2960的交换机,网线重做过,现在就是没有换过网卡
还有该机器老报swap交换区不足,这个会不会对网卡有些影响?
请各位老大帮忙看看,有没有遇到过这种情况?
这种问题该从何处下手?
-----------------------------------------------------------
09-07-21
我登陆交换机报如下信息
1y11w: %CDP-4-DUPLEX_MISMATCH: duplex mismatch discovered on FastEthernet0/48 (n
ot half duplex), with Switch FastEthernet0/7 (half duplex).
------------------------------------------------------------
这是网速经常变慢的端口的show int f0/44 和46的输出
FastEthernet0/44 is down, line protocol is down (notconnect)
  Hardware is Fast Ethernet, address is 001e.bda4.ce2c (bia 001e.bda4.ce2c)
  MTU 1500 bytes, BW 100000 Kbit, DLY 100 usec,
     reliability 255/255, txload 1/255, rxload 1/255
  Encapsulation ARPA, loopback not set
  Keepalive set (10 sec)
  Auto-duplex, Auto-speed, media type is 10/100BaseTX
  input flow-control is off, output flow-control is unsupported
  ARP type: ARPA, ARP Timeout 04:00:00
  Last input never, output 01:43:00, outp
1y20w: %CDP-4-DUPLEX_MISMATCH: duplex mismatch discovered on FastEthernet0/48 (n
ot half duplex), with Switch FastEthernet0/1 (half duplex).ut hang never
  Last clearing of "show interface" counters never
  Input queue: 0/75/0/0 (size/max/drops/flushes); Total output drops: 0
  Queueing strategy: fifo
  Output queue: 0/40 (size/max)
  5 minute input rate 0 bits/sec, 0 packets/sec
  5 minute output rate 0 bits/sec, 0 packets/sec
     792114824 packets input, 579970955607 bytes, 0 no buffer
     Received 251830408 broadcasts (0 multicasts)
     0 runts, 6326 giants, 0 throttles
     3157240 input errors, 1552225 CRC, 0 frame, 0 overrun, 0 ignored
     0 watchdog, 2 multicast, 1920254 pause input
     0 input packets with dribble condition detected
     1908412976 packets output, 936317846492 bytes, 0 underruns
     0 output errors, 25957907 collisions, 1 interface resets
     0 babbles, 0 late collision, 0 deferred


FastEthernet0/46 is down, line protocol is down (notconnect)
  Hardware is Fast Ethernet, address is 001e.bda4.ce2e (bia 001e.bda4.ce2e)
  MTU 1500 bytes, BW 100000 Kbit, DLY 100 usec,
     reliability 255/255, txload 1/255, rxload 1/255
  Encapsulation ARPA, loopback not set
  Keepalive set (10 sec)
  Auto-duplex, Auto-speed, media type is 10/100BaseTX
  input flow-control is off, output flow-control is unsupported
  ARP type: ARPA, ARP Timeout 04:00:00
  Last input never, output 02:10:41, output hang never
  Last clearing of "show interface" counters never
  Input queue: 0/75/0/0 (size/max/drops/flushes); Total output drops: 0
  Queueing strategy: fifo
  Output queue: 0/40 (size/max)
  5 minute input rate 0 bits/sec, 0 packets/sec
  5 minute output rate 0 bits/sec, 0 packets/sec
     1687137142 packets input, 1276909676693 bytes, 0 no buffer
     Received 706110934 broadcasts (0 multicasts)
     0 runts, 719 giants, 0 throttles
     461097 input errors, 228038 CRC, 0 frame, 0 overrun, 0 ignored
     0 watchdog, 6 multicast, 0 pause input
     0 input packets with dribble condition detected
     1998364888 packets output, 735360128887 bytes, 0 underruns
----------------------------------------------------------------------------------------
自从7月23号将交换机的端口和DS20机器的网卡模式改成一致后(均为100M半双工),
一直到现在(8月11日)机器的网速均未出现变慢的情况
困扰一年多的问题就此解决,深层次的原因还望各位高手解惑
^_^
非常感谢ssffzz1 和kentchoi 大侠
附修改方法:
将2960上交换机上的4个和DS20网卡相连端口强制改成100M 半双工,网卡以前设置的是100M半双工

[ 本帖最后由 gawk 于 2009-8-11 17:59 编辑 ]

最佳答案

查看完整内容

errors:2345出现这个问题的原因是网卡上面收到了错误的帧,可能的问题一般是硬件问题比较多。尝试更换网线,还有检查一下网口等。另外在ping丢包的时候看看这个参数增加不,如果增加的话,可以考虑触碰网线的各个接头,看是否有改善。如果排除网线问题的话,可以尝试更换网卡。和软件的关系不是很大,但也不排除驱动的问题。另外这个状况还有和另一端网卡工作模式不匹配有关系,如果可以贴出另一端网卡的ifconfig数据,或者直接强 ...

论坛徽章:
5
IT运维版块每日发帖之星
日期:2015-08-06 06:20:00IT运维版块每日发帖之星
日期:2015-08-10 06:20:00IT运维版块每日发帖之星
日期:2015-08-23 06:20:00IT运维版块每日发帖之星
日期:2015-08-24 06:20:00IT运维版块每日发帖之星
日期:2015-11-12 06:20:00
发表于 2009-07-20 15:09 |显示全部楼层
errors:2345

出现这个问题的原因是网卡上面收到了错误的帧,可能的问题一般是硬件问题比较多。尝试更换网线,还有检查一下网口等。

另外在ping丢包的时候看看这个参数增加不,如果增加的话,可以考虑触碰网线的各个接头,看是否有改善。

如果排除网线问题的话,可以尝试更换网卡。

和软件的关系不是很大,但也不排除驱动的问题。


另外这个状况还有和另一端网卡工作模式不匹配有关系,如果可以贴出另一端网卡的ifconfig数据,或者直接强制双工模式以及速率试试。

[ 本帖最后由 ssffzz1 于 2009-7-20 15:15 编辑 ]

论坛徽章:
0
发表于 2009-07-20 15:17 |显示全部楼层
40% 的丢包率是很多了。。

流量大吗?接口速率都配置过了吗?

论坛徽章:
0
发表于 2009-07-20 15:24 |显示全部楼层
原帖由 ssffzz1 于 2009-7-20 15:13 发表
errors:2345

出现这个问题的原因是网卡上面收到了错误的帧,可能的问题一般是硬件问题比较多。尝试更换网线,还有检查一下网口等。

另外在ping丢包的时候看看这个参数增加不,如果增加的话,可以考虑触碰 ...

交换机是用的cisco 2960但是没有做配置,网卡有没有做配置,应该是自适应的,这种情况会不会导致这个问题?
另外我以前问过一个问题,就是网卡速度突然由100M变为10k的样子的,也是在这个环境下
有时候交换机上的端口上的灯会闪一下橙色

论坛徽章:
0
发表于 2009-07-20 15:27 |显示全部楼层
两边配置一下看看吧,,,以前某个intel网卡,在linux的驱动下跟cisco 2960 确实发生过适应问题。。。

论坛徽章:
0
发表于 2009-07-20 15:32 |显示全部楼层
原帖由 kentchoi 于 2009-7-20 15:27 发表
两边配置一下看看吧,,,以前某个intel网卡,在linux的驱动下跟cisco 2960 确实发生过适应问题。。。

是现场的环境,看起来比较麻烦,上面还有hp DS20的两台机器,经常会出现网速变成10k的现象,很折磨人

论坛徽章:
0
发表于 2009-07-20 15:33 |显示全部楼层
网速10K 是什么意思?不是10M 半双工?

论坛徽章:
0
发表于 2009-07-20 15:41 |显示全部楼层
原帖由 kentchoi 于 2009-7-20 15:33 发表
网速10K 是什么意思?不是10M 半双工?

用ftp和scp测试下载100m的文件,速度变为10k/s了
正常时速度大概80M/s左右

论坛徽章:
5
IT运维版块每日发帖之星
日期:2015-08-06 06:20:00IT运维版块每日发帖之星
日期:2015-08-10 06:20:00IT运维版块每日发帖之星
日期:2015-08-23 06:20:00IT运维版块每日发帖之星
日期:2015-08-24 06:20:00IT运维版块每日发帖之星
日期:2015-11-12 06:20:00
发表于 2009-07-20 15:53 |显示全部楼层
先试试强制速率的方法吧。交换机和网卡同时强制100M全双工

论坛徽章:
0
发表于 2009-07-20 15:56 |显示全部楼层
原帖由 ssffzz1 于 2009-7-20 15:53 发表
先试试强制速率的方法吧。交换机和网卡同时强制100M全双工

嗯,准备这样操作,先和用户商量一下
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P